[Thyrotropin reference ranges during pregnancy in the province of Huelva, Spain].

Semergen 2018 September
OBJECTIVE: The correct diagnosis of hypothyroidism during pregnancy requires knowledge of the local trimester-specific thyrotropin (TSH) reference ranges. When these are not available, the guidelines recommend upper limits of 2.5, 3.0, and 3.0μU/ml for the 1st , 2nd , and 3rd trimesters, respectively. The aim is to establish the reference range for our local population.

MATERIAL AND METHODS: A population-based observational study was performed on healthy pregnant women from 11 healthcare centres in the province of Huelva. Women were recruited consecutively during 2016 through the pregnancy process. Women were excluded who had a history of thyroid or medical disease, a poor obstetric history, multiple pregnancy, thyroid autoimmunity, and extreme TSH values (<0.4μU/ml or>10μU/ml), as well as women treated with levothyroxine for thyroid dysfunction.

RESULTS: The study included a total of 186 pregnant women, with a mean age of 30.7 years (95% CI: 29.8-31.6) and a body mass index (BMI) of 23.6 (95% CI: 23.2-24.0). Most of them had the first laboratory tests performed before week 11 of pregnancy. Valid subjects for analysis were 145, 105, and 67 pregnant women in the 1st , 2nd , and 3rd trimesters, respectively, after excluding those due to abortion (18.9%), autoimmunity (6.5%), hypo/hyperthyroidism (2.2%), and levothyroxine treatment during the 2nd /3rd trimester (18.6%). The 97.5% TSH percentile for the 1st , 2nd , and 3rd trimester was 4.68, 4.83, and 4.57μU/ml, respectively. Thyroid dysfunction was identified in 80 women (55.2%), 33 of whom received treatment with Levothyroxine (22.7%). With the new criteria, thyroid dysfunction prevalence would be reduced to 6.2%, and the need for treatment to 4.1%.

CONCLUSION: The reference range for TSH in our population differs from that proposed by the guidelines. Unnecessary treatment was being given to 18.6% of pregnant women.
